#!/usr/bin/env python3
|
|
import os
|
|
import sys
|
|
import argparse
|
|
from pathlib import Path
|
|
|
|
def combine_paths(paths, output_file):
|
|
"""Combine multiple paths into a single text file."""
|
|
with open(output_file, 'w', encoding='utf-8') as out:
|
|
for path_str in paths:
|
|
path = Path(path_str)
|
|
|
|
if not path.exists():
|
|
print(f"Warning: {path} does not exist, skipping...")
|
|
continue
|
|
|
|
out.write(f"\n{'='*80}\n")
|
|
out.write(f"PATH: {path}\n")
|
|
out.write(f"{'='*80}\n\n")
|
|
|
|
if path.is_file():
|
|
try:
|
|
with open(path, 'r', encoding='utf-8') as f:
|
|
out.write(f.read())
|
|
out.write('\n\n')
|
|
except UnicodeDecodeError:
|
|
out.write(f"[Binary file - skipped]\n\n")
|
|
except Exception as e:
|
|
out.write(f"[Error reading file: {e}]\n\n")
|
|
|
|
elif path.is_dir():
|
|
for root, dirs, files in os.walk(path):
|
|
# Skip common ignored directories
|
|
dirs[:] = [d for d in dirs if not d.startswith('.') and d not in ['node_modules', '__pycache__', 'target', 'dist', 'build']]
|
|
|
|
for file in files:
|
|
if file.startswith('.'):
|
|
continue
|
|
|
|
file_path = Path(root) / file
|
|
out.write(f"\n{'-'*60}\n")
|
|
out.write(f"FILE: {file_path}\n")
|
|
out.write(f"{'-'*60}\n\n")
|
|
|
|
try:
|
|
with open(file_path, 'r', encoding='utf-8') as f:
|
|
out.write(f.read())
|
|
out.write('\n\n')
|
|
except UnicodeDecodeError:
|
|
out.write(f"[Binary file - skipped]\n\n")
|
|
except Exception as e:
|
|
out.write(f"[Error reading file: {e}]\n\n")
|
|
|
|
def main():
|
|
parser = argparse.ArgumentParser(description='Combine multiple paths into a single text file')
|
|
parser.add_argument('paths', nargs='+', help='Paths to combine')
|
|
parser.add_argument('-o', '--output', help='Output file name (default: foldername.txt based on first path)')
|
|
|
|
args = parser.parse_args()
|
|
|
|
if args.output:
|
|
output_file = args.output
|
|
else:
|
|
first_path = Path(args.paths[0])
|
|
folder_name = first_path.name if first_path.is_dir() else first_path.stem
|
|
output_file = f"{folder_name}.txt"
|
|
|
|
combine_paths(args.paths, output_file)
|
|
print(f"Combined {len(args.paths)} paths into {output_file}")
|
|
|
|
if __name__ == "__main__":
|
|
main() |
